End-tidal carbon dioxide measurements in critically ill neonates: a comparison of side-stream and mainstream capnometers
Abstract
To determine whether end-tidal PCO2 (PETCO2) measurements obtained with two infrared capnometers accurately approximates the arterial PCO2 PaCO2) in critically ill neonates, simultaneous measurements of PETCO2 were obtained from the distal and proximal ends of the tracheal tube with a sidestream capnometer (Puritan Bennett/Datex — BP/D) and from the proximal end with a mainstream capnometer (Hewlett-Packard — HP) in 20 intubated neonates. …
